Description
UBE2W encodes a member of the ubiquitin-conjugating enzyme (E2) family. This enzyme catalyzes the second step in ubiquitination, transferring ubiquitin from an E1 enzyme to a substrate-specific E3 ligase. UBE2W is involved in protein quality control, DNA damage response, and regulation of transcription factors. It is widely expressed and has been implicated in cancer and neurodegenerative disorders.

Protein Summary
UBE2W is a 170-amino acid protein with a conserved ubiquitin-conjugating catalytic domain. It interacts with various E3 ligases to ubiquitinate substrates, including p53 and histones. The protein is localized to the nucleus and cytoplasm and is essential for cellular homeostasis.
